本文目录导读:
随着互联网的快速发展,越来越多的人希望通过搭建自己的网站来实现个人或企业的信息传播、品牌推广等功能,对于许多初学者来说,如何从源码搭建网站仍然是一个难题,本文将从源码入手,详细解析网站搭建的各个环节,帮助大家轻松入门。
网站搭建前的准备工作
1、确定网站类型:在搭建网站之前,首先要明确自己的需求,确定网站的类型,如个人博客、企业官网、电子商务平台等。
图片来源于网络,如有侵权联系删除
2、选择合适的域名:域名是网站的网址,选择一个简洁、易记的域名对于网站推广至关重要,可以通过各大域名注册商进行查询和注册。
3、购买服务器:根据网站类型和预期访问量,选择合适的云服务器或物理服务器,服务器选择应考虑带宽、存储空间、CPU、内存等因素。
4、了解编程语言和开发工具:根据网站需求,选择合适的编程语言和开发工具,常见的编程语言有HTML、CSS、JavaScript、PHP、Python等;开发工具有Visual Studio Code、Sublime Text、Atom等。
网站搭建步骤
1、网站结构设计:在搭建网站之前,需要先设计网站的结构,包括页面布局、导航栏、内容区等,可以使用原型设计工具,如Axure RP、Sketch等,绘制网站原型。
2、前端开发:根据网站原型,使用HTML、CSS、JavaScript等技术进行前端开发,主要包括以下几个方面:
(1)HTML:编写网站的骨架,定义页面结构和内容。
(2)CSS:美化页面,设置字体、颜色、布局等样式。
(3)JavaScript:实现页面交互功能,如表单验证、动画效果等。
图片来源于网络,如有侵权联系删除
3、后端开发:后端开发主要负责处理用户请求、数据库操作、服务器配置等,以下是一些常见后端技术:
(1)PHP:一种服务器端脚本语言,广泛应用于网站开发。
(2)Python:一种高级编程语言,具有丰富的库和框架,如Django、Flask等。
(3)Java:一种面向对象的编程语言,广泛应用于企业级应用开发。
4、数据库设计:根据网站需求,设计数据库结构,如MySQL、MongoDB等,数据库设计主要包括以下几个方面:
(1)数据表设计:定义数据表字段、类型、约束等。
(2)数据关系设计:确定数据表之间的关联关系。
5、部署上线:将网站代码上传到服务器,进行配置和测试,确保网站能够正常运行。
图片来源于网络,如有侵权联系删除
网站优化与维护
1、优化网站性能:通过压缩图片、合并CSS/JavaScript文件、缓存等技术,提高网站加载速度。
2、SEO优化:通过关键词优化、网站结构优化、外链建设等手段,提高网站在搜索引擎中的排名。
3、网站安全:定期更新网站程序,修复漏洞,防止黑客攻击。
4、数据备份:定期备份网站数据,以防数据丢失。
通过以上步骤,我们可以从源码搭建一个属于自己的网站,实际操作中可能还会遇到各种问题,需要不断学习和实践,希望本文能为大家提供一定的参考和帮助,祝大家搭建网站顺利!
标签: #怎么用源码搭建网站
评论列表